五金厂用什么编程
-
五金厂通常会使用多种编程语言来完成不同的任务。以下是五金厂常用的几种编程语言:
-
C语言:C语言是一种通用的编程语言,被广泛用于嵌入式系统和底层开发。在五金厂中,C语言常被用于控制系统的编程,例如编写与机械设备相关的控制程序。
-
PLC编程:PLC(可编程逻辑控制器)是五金厂中常用的控制设备。PLC编程通常使用Ladder Diagram(梯形图)或Structured Text(结构化文本)这样的特定编程语言。这些语言专门用于控制工业自动化设备,如机械臂、输送带等。
-
Python:Python是一种高级编程语言,具有简洁易读的语法和强大的库支持。在五金厂中,Python常被用于数据处理、分析和可视化,以及自动化任务的编程。
-
CAD/CAM编程:CAD(计算机辅助设计)和CAM(计算机辅助制造)是五金加工中常用的工具。CAD/CAM编程通常使用特定的软件,如AutoCAD、SolidWorks等,用于设计和生成加工路径。
-
机器人编程:五金厂中常使用机器人来完成重复性的工作,如焊接、搬运等。机器人编程可以使用特定的编程语言,如RoboDK、ABB RobotStudio等,用于控制机器人的动作和路径规划。
需要注意的是,不同的五金厂可能会根据自身需求选择不同的编程语言。以上列举的编程语言只是一些常见的例子,具体使用哪种编程语言还需要根据具体情况而定。
1年前 -
-
五金厂通常使用各种编程语言和软件来完成不同的任务和操作。以下是五金厂常用的编程方式:
-
自动化控制编程:五金厂中的自动化生产线通常使用PLC(可编程逻辑控制器)来控制和监控设备和机器的操作。PLC编程语言通常使用类似于Ladder Diagram(梯形图)或Structured Text(结构化文本)的语言。这些编程语言允许工程师编写逻辑控制程序,以确保设备按照预定的顺序和方式运行。
-
机器人编程:五金厂中常用的机器人包括焊接机器人、搬运机器人和装配机器人等。这些机器人通常使用专门的机器人控制器,并使用特定的机器人编程语言来实现各种动作和任务。常用的机器人编程语言包括ABB的RAPID、Fanuc的Karel和KUKA的KRL等。
-
CAD/CAM编程:五金厂中的设计和制造过程通常使用计算机辅助设计(CAD)和计算机辅助制造(CAM)软件。这些软件允许工程师使用图形界面进行设计和编程,以生成零件的几何模型和加工路径。常用的CAD/CAM软件包括AutoCAD、SolidWorks、Mastercam等。
-
数控编程:五金厂中的数控机床通常使用数控编程来控制刀具和工件的运动。数控编程语言通常是一种特定的G代码或M代码,通过编写指令来控制机床的运动、速度和工具的选择等。常用的数控编程语言包括G代码、ISO编程和Fanuc的Macro编程等。
-
数据分析和处理编程:五金厂中的生产数据和质量数据通常需要进行分析和处理。工程师可以使用各种编程语言和软件来处理数据,例如Python、R、MATLAB等。这些编程语言提供了强大的数据处理和分析功能,可以帮助工程师识别生产过程中的问题和改进机器的性能。
总之,五金厂使用的编程方式取决于具体的任务和操作。从自动化控制到机器人编程,再到CAD/CAM和数控编程,以及数据分析和处理编程,五金厂的编程需求非常多样化。
1年前 -
-
五金厂在生产过程中需要使用编程来控制设备和机器的运行。常见的五金厂编程包括以下几种类型:
-
数控编程:数控编程主要用于数控机床,通过编写数控程序来控制机床的运动轨迹、加工速度等参数,实现对工件的精确加工。数控编程一般使用G代码和M代码进行编写,G代码用于控制机床的运动轨迹,M代码用于控制机床的辅助功能。
-
PLC编程:PLC编程是针对可编程逻辑控制器(PLC)的编程,用于控制和监控生产线上的各种设备和机器。PLC编程一般使用类似于梯形图的图形化编程语言,通过连接输入输出模块和逻辑控制模块,实现对设备的控制和监测。
-
机器人编程:随着自动化技术的发展,越来越多的五金厂开始使用机器人来完成生产任务。机器人编程主要用于编写机器人的运动轨迹和动作序列,通过控制机器人的关节和末端执行器,实现对工件的抓取、放置和加工等操作。
-
编程控制系统:除了上述的特定编程方式外,五金厂还可能使用其他的编程控制系统来实现对设备和机器的控制,例如使用LabVIEW进行仪器控制和数据采集,使用Python或C++进行自动化控制等。
五金厂选择使用哪种编程方式取决于具体的生产需求和设备特点。不同的编程方式有不同的应用范围和技术要求,需要根据实际情况进行选择和学习。同时,随着技术的发展和进步,五金厂也可以结合使用多种编程方式来实现更高效、精确和自动化的生产。
1年前 -